What we all need to do is take off our P&G glasses and look at our opponents. It is not about how good is our talent but how good are they relative to everyone else.

Just some important preseason notes on this issue:

Bama (and tOSU) does not have a QB on the roster with a start.
aTm does not have a QB with a start.
UF - QB does not have a start but has 2 yrs with the team.
Auburn - QB is a 2 yr starter. Hopefully he has hit his ceiling.
UGA is loaded and has a QB with some experience.
OMiss - experienced QB.
MSU - ???

Why am I focusing on QB's? In my numerous years of watching SEC and NCAA the top teams have usually have an experienced QB and always is a dominant QB.
